What does "fathom" imply?

Prepare for the General Education 1 Vocabulary Test. Enhance your vocabulary knowledge with flashcards and multiple choice questions complete with hints and explanations. Get ready to excel!

The term "fathom" implies the ability to understand something deeply, often following considerable thought or analysis. In contexts where complex subjects or difficult problems are involved, to "fathom" means to achieve clarity and comprehension after engaging with the material. It suggests an active effort to explore and grasp the intricacies of a topic, leading to a deeper insight.
